Understanding the Advantages and Limitations of PayID in Casinos
What makes PayID stand out is not just its speed but how it fits into the Australian regulatory environment. With local banks and institutions backing it, PayID offers dependable security protocols and a lower risk of fraud compared to other online payment systems. For gamblers wary of sharing sensitive credit card details or relying on e-wallets, this direct bank-to-bank transfer presents a welcome alternative.
Still, it’s important to recognize that PayID payments are generally irreversible once sent, so accuracy in entering recipient details is crucial. Also, while most major Australian banks support PayID, some smaller or international players might not, potentially limiting options for certain users. This blend of convenience and caution means users need to be attentive, but the benefits often outweigh the risks.
How to Navigate PayID Casino Australia Like a Pro
Managing your payments through PayID at Australian casinos can be straightforward if you keep a few tips in mind. First, always double-check the PayID information provided by the casino—errors here can lead to lost funds. It’s also wise to test the transaction with a small amount before committing larger deposits or withdrawals.
Here are some practical steps to follow:
- Verify your bank supports PayID and ensure your account is linked properly.
- Use the casino’s official payment page to find their PayID details instead of relying on third-party sources.
- Keep records of your transfers and confirm receipt with the casino’s customer service if there’s any delay.
- Be mindful of transaction limits and processing times, especially during weekends or holidays.
- Set a budget to gamble responsibly and avoid chasing losses, regardless of payment convenience.
